- ·上一篇:EXCEL表格怎么按班级总分排
- ·下一篇:EXCEL表格怎么默认取消公式限制
EXCEL表格怎么每三行换一个颜色
1.EXCEL中如何把连续不同内容的三行标出颜色
对A3单元格应用条件格式,自定义,再应用到A列:=IFERROR(AND(A1<>A2,A2<>A3,A1<>A3),0)+IFERROR(AND(A1048576<>A1,A1<>A2,A2<>A1048576),0)+IFERROR(AND(A1048575<>A1048576,A1048575<>A1,A1048576<>A1),0)
2.如何使电子表格每隔一行变换颜色,让人看起来清楚一些?
按以下方法做,即可实现。 第一步——插入Excel电子表格:用Word 2007打开或新建将要插入表格的文档,依次点击菜单栏“插入”→“表格”→“Excel电子表格”,就可以插入一个与普通Excel文档并无二致的表格,通过鼠标拖拽的方法来可以增加表格的可视行或列(图1)。双击选中它,就可以在其中进行Excel表格的编辑操作(比如可以增加多个工作簿,不过当它保存为Word文档时,显示的只有当前打开的工作簿内容,但双击该表格又可以在其中看到所有的工作簿内容)。 第二步——给表格的偶数行着色:切换到Word 2007 的“开始”选项卡,选中工作簿,单击“条件格式”→“管理规则”,在随后出现的“条件格式规则管理器”窗口中,点击“新建规则”,选择“使用公式确定要设置格式的单元格”规则类型,在“为符合此公式的值设置格式”中输入:=MOD(ROW(),2)=0(图2),并点击“格式”按钮,设置“填充”颜色及“边框”颜色。 第三步——给表格的奇数行着色:仿照第二步,输入公式:=MOD(ROW(),2)=0,并设置不同的“填充”颜色及相同的“边框”颜色。
3.怎么设置excel每点一行有颜色
给你写一段VBA代码
进入VBA,双击左侧的工作名,进入工作表的代码编辑窗口,下接复制粘贴以下代码:
Dim RowNo As Long
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
If Target.Cells.Count = 1 Then
If RowNo 0 Then
With Rows(RowNo & ":" & RowNo).Interior
.Pattern = xlNone
.TintAndShade = 0
.PatternTintAndShade = 0
End With
End If
RowNo = Target.Row
With Rows(RowNo & ":" & RowNo).Interior
.Pattern = xlSolid
.PatternColorIndex = xlAutomatic
.Color = RGB(180, 180, 180)
.TintAndShade = 0
.PatternTintAndShade = 0
End With
End If
End Sub
'RGB(180, 180, 180)是RGB三色模式的颜色,你可以调整成想要呈现的底色
'我好像误解了题主的意思,我上面的代码是不选中整行变色,而是选中任何一个单元格时,这个单元格所在的行就会底色变灰(而选中了多个单元格,包括整行时,都不会变色)
